Purpose of Export-Import Bank
State the purpose of Export-Import Bank?
Expert
Export-Import Bank or EXIM bank of United States was founded to be an independent government agency that facilitate and finance U.S. export trade. EXIM bank’s purpose is to offer does finance in conditions where the private financial institutions are not able or unwilling as:
a) Loan maturity was too long;
b) Amount of loan was really too large;
c) Loan risk was too great; and,
d) Where the importing firm had difficulty in obtaining the hard currency for payment. In order to meet its objectives, EXIM bank offers service through three types of programs: direct loans to the borrowers of foreign, loan guarantees, and the credit insurance.
